Taxonomic Classification

Rank 阿拉伯石雞 Black-capped Fruit Bat
Kingdom same Animalia (动物界) Animalia (动物界)
Phylum same Chordata (脊索动物门) Chordata (脊索动物门)
Class Aves (鳥綱) Mammalia (哺乳動物)
Order Galliformes (鸡形目) Chiroptera (翼手目)
Family Phasianidae Pteropodidae (Fruit Bats)
Genus Alectoris Chironax
Species Alectoris melanocephala Chironax melanocephalus

Evolutionary Relationship

阿拉伯石雞 and Black-capped Fruit Bat share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(脊索动物门)
